Fitting of cargo doorThe front-end of the fuselage section is opened up in 2 stages for the installation of the cargo door. The upper frame stick is held at its position and is secured by riveting the frame to the fuselage. The over-the-hill depress frame shell section is substituted with a new lower frame shell that is lowered into the prepared cut-out location and incorporated strongly to the airframe. The frames forrard and aft of the cut-out are entirely replaced by reinforced frames. After the installation of the frames, electric comp mavinnts and hydraulic systems are added for the cargo door to operate with ease. (SPG Media Limited, 2010. The next few paragraphs will explain and boom more on the benefits and limitations of P2F conversion.4.1 Benefits4.1.1 Saves costCompanies around the world who are face to purchase freighter cargo aircraft would most likely try to celebrate up on anything they can save on. One of the benefits of P2F conversions is that it helps companies sav e money. A P2F converted aircraft costs nearly one third of a freighter aircraft made from scratch. Since its just part of the aircraft that is reconstructed, it will help save cost on the amount of material used. When there is less work to be done, less manpower is needed. Hence they can save cost by employing fewer engineers to work. Therefore, P2F conversions help save money for companies.
